[QUOTE="Marshall, post: 3184057, member: 21705"]This was a tough one, but I believe it is the S-185. R2. Obverse 33 was used on S-184 and S-185. on Noyes Die State/Stage D, a crack developes from the forehead through the base of Y. My usual obverse comp does not show this crack. (BTW, My comps are mostly from the Holmes Collection with some supplements from elsewhere) But I did see it in Noyes. It appears rather distinct on yours, so probably Die Stage/State E. Here is a comp, also from Holmes, of his late state S-185. [ATTACH=full]821000[/ATTACH] Reverse FF is only used on the S-185. Notable features are the numerator slightly left of center while the fraction bar is shifted right of center. The point of the leaf is just left of the right upright of M. The berry right of E is even with the top serif. And on this example, shows the clash under the triplet below O. This is the Holmes Comp. [ATTACH=full]821002[/ATTACH][/QUOTE]
